Painel de Admin

O centro de comando da tua liga.

O botão Admin no topo do ecrã abre o painel de controlo completo: liga, sedes, membros, jogadores, convites, lixo e manutenção. Aqui tens tudo o que cada secção faz.

7
Secções
4
Funções de acesso
CSV
Importar/Exportar
Backups
00

Visão geral

O painel admin abre-se a partir do chip Admin na barra superior de qualquer liga onde tenhas permissões. É o único ecrã onde podes editar a liga, gerir pessoas e mexer em dados.

O que encontras em Admin

  1. Liga — configuração, edição, eliminação, mudança entre as tuas ligas.
  2. Sedes — adiciona e edita os clubes onde jogam.
  3. Membros — quem tem acesso à liga e com que função (só cloud).
  4. Jogadores — o plantel; vincular contas, marcar convidados, fundir…
  5. Convites — registo de novos membros por email (só cloud).
  6. Lixo — partidas eliminadas recuperáveis.
  7. Manutenção — CSV, backups e reset (em Opções avançadas).
Modo local vs Cloud Em modo local (sem Google Sign-In) só vês Liga, Sedes e Jogadores. Membros e Convites requerem conta cloud porque partilham dados entre dispositivos.
Admin
FAS Médio/Alto
P
Liga ativa
Ano · 2026 · Outdoor
Proprietário
8
Jogadores
24
Partidas
1020
Líder ELO
— Secções —
Liga
Sedes
Jogadores
Membros
01

Funções & permissões

Quatro funções. O proprietário é um único e manda em tudo; o resto está numa hierarquia de permissões descendente.

★ Proprietário

Proprietário

Quem criou a liga. É o único que pode eliminá-la ou transferir a propriedade. Tem todas as permissões de admin além disso.

Admin

Administrador

Acesso completo a todas as secções. Pode convidar pessoas, mudar funções (exceto transferir proprietário), editar liga e dados.

Editor

Editor

Gere jogadores e partidas. Não vê a secção Membros nem Convites. Não pode eliminar liga nem editar a configuração base.

Leitor

Leitor

Só consulta. Vê rankings, sedes e partidas, mas não pode modificar nada. Útil para convidar familiares ou adeptos.

O que cada função pode fazer

AçãoProprietárioAdminEditorLeitor
Ver rankings e partidas
Criar/editar partidas
Editar plantel de jogadores
Convidar membros / mudar funções
Editar configuração da liga
Reset de temporada / Manutenção
Eliminar liga
Transferir propriedade
Transferência de propriedade Se és proprietário e queres sair da liga, primeiro tens de transferir a função de proprietário a outro membro. O sistema pede-o automaticamente. A liga nunca fica sem proprietário.
02

Secção Liga

O cartão verde do topo: identidade, métricas-chave e atalhos para mudar entre as tuas ligas ou gerir a atual.

Cartão de Liga Ativa

Vista resumo em gradiente verde com o nome da liga, modo de temporada (Ano/Temporada/Sem), sede por defeito e o botão ⚙️ para abrir a configuração avançada. Por baixo, métricas:

  • Total de jogadores no plantel.
  • Partidas jogadas com resultado.
  • Líder ELO atual.
  • Pagador de cervejas (quem mais rondas deve segundo o ranking de cervejas).

Gestão de liga

Criar liga
Só visível em modo cloud. Lança o assistente de 4 passos. Quando já tens ligas, as novas adicionam-se à tua lista.
Editar liga
Muda tipo de temporada, sede por defeito, limite de duplas. O tipo dinâmica/estática não pode ser alterado — isso é para sempre.
Eliminar liga
Só proprietário. Apaga-se tudo: jogadores, partidas, sedes, histórico. Sem lixo nem rollback. Pediremos confirmação com o nome.
Sair da liga
Só visível se és membro mas não proprietário. Se és proprietário, antes obrigamos-te a transferir a propriedade.

As minhas ligas (só cloud)

Lista de todas as ligas a que pertences com a tua função atual ao lado. Toca Usar em qualquer uma para mudar a liga ativa imediatamente — os outros ecrãs (rankings, partidas…) atualizam-se.

Modo local Se entras sem conta, só há uma liga no dispositivo. Não há lista "As minhas ligas". Se depois fizeres Sign-In, oferecemos-te migrar essa liga para a cloud.
Liga
F
FAS Médio/Alto
Ano · 2026 · 8 duplas
16
Jogadores
42
Partidas
1024
Líder
— Gestão —
Criar liga
Editar
Eliminar liga
— As minhas ligas —
F
FAS Médio/Alto
Ativa
L
Segundas Indoor
Usar
03

Sedes

As sedes são os clubes onde jogam. A sede principal cria-se no wizard inicial; aqui adicionas mais e editas todas.

Adicionar sede
Diálogo com campos: nome, morada (com preenchimento automático), cidade, distrito, país, código postal e tipo de campo (outdoor / indoor / ambos).
Editar sede
Qualquer campo. Se mudares a morada recalculamos as coordenadas para a previsão meteorológica.
Eliminar sede
Pedimos confirmação. As partidas passadas conservam a sede registada mesmo que a apagues depois.
Geocoding grátis Usamos OpenStreetMap (Nominatim) para preencher a morada e Open-Meteo para o tempo. Sem chaves de API que expiram, sem custo para ti.
Dica Se a tua liga joga em várias sedes, cria-as todas aqui. Ao criar cada partida poderás escolher a sede concreta — útil para grupos itinerantes.
Sedes
3 sedes registadas
C
Club Padel FAS
Lisboa · Outdoor
Por defeito
P
Padel Indoor Norte
Lisboa · Indoor
T
Top Padel Center
Porto · Ambos
+ Adicionar sede
04

Membros

Quem tem acesso à liga e com que função. Só visível se a liga estiver na cloud. Aqui mudas funções e expulsas quem sobra.

O que vês por cada membro

Avatar, nome, email e função atual. Se houver mais de 5 membros aparece uma barra de pesquisa por nome ou email.

Ações (só proprietário/admin)

Mudar função
De editor para admin ou vice-versa. Se quiseres tornar alguém proprietário, fá-lo a partir de "Transferir propriedade" (secção Liga).
Remover da liga
O membro perde acesso mas o seu histórico de partidas mantém-se (fica como jogador não vinculado).
Badge vermelho Se tiveres convites enviados pendentes de aceitação, aparece um contador vermelho sobre o menu. Lembra-te de que há gente que ainda não entrou.
Membros (4)
P
Pablo
prabago…@gmail.com
Proprietário
D
Diego
diego@…
Admin
F
Fernando
fer@…
Editor
O
Óscar
oscar@…
Leitor
05

Jogadores

O plantel — quem joga as partidas. Distinto de Membros: aqui estão os que aparecem em rankings, tenham conta ou não.

Cada jogador pode ter

  • Vínculo a uma conta (badge "Vinculado") → vê o seu ELO no telemóvel dele.
  • Dupla fixa (se a liga for estática).
  • Marca de convidado → as suas partidas não somam ELO a ninguém.

Menu contextual (3 pontos)

Renomear
O nome aparece em rankings, partidas e exportações.
Vincular conta
Liga o jogador a um membro da liga (por email). Quando vinculado, esse membro vê as suas estatísticas pessoais no home.
Atribuir dupla
Só em ligas estáticas. Validamos que não ultrapassas o limite (se o fixaste entre 4-12).
Marcar como convidado
As suas partidas não contam para ELO nem para a tabela. Útil para visitantes pontuais.
Fundir com outro
Se criaste o mesmo jogador duas vezes, podes fundi-los e o histórico passa para o jogador destino. Operação só de admin.
Eliminar
Bloqueado se tiver partidas jogadas, partidas abertas, ou estiver vinculado a uma conta. Desvincula e apaga as partidas antes se quiseres forçar.
Jogadores (4)
P
Pablo
Dupla: Diego
Admin
D
Diego
Dupla: Pablo
Vinculado
F
Fernando
Dupla: Óscar
V
Visitante
Sem dupla
Convidado
+ Adicionar jogador
06

Convites

Gestão de convites por email. Só na cloud. Dois fluxos: os que recebes tu e os que enviaste e ainda não foram aceites.

Enviar convite

Botão + Convidar abre um diálogo onde escreves o email do convidado e escolhes a função inicial (leitor, editor, admin). Recebe notificação push se tiver a app instalada, ou um email se não.

Convites pendentes

  • Enviados por ti → mostra email + função proposta. Botão Retirar se mudares de ideias.
  • Recebidos → convites para ligas de outros. Botões Aceitar / Rejeitar.
Função de entrada Os convidados não são membros até aceitarem. Entretanto podes retirar o convite sem consequências. Uma vez aceite, geres-os a partir de Membros.

Link de convite público

Além dos convites por email um a um, podes gerar um link partilhável tipo padelrank.pro/j/ABC123XY e enviá-lo por WhatsApp ou onde quiseres. Quem o abre solicita entrar — tu aprovas ou rejeitas a partir da fila pendente. Ninguém entra sem o teu OK.

  • Vários links em simultâneo com etiquetas próprias (ex. "Sócios 2026", "Convidados Junho").
  • Validade opcional: nunca / 7 / 30 / 90 dias.
  • Auto-aprovação por domínio de email (requer plano CLUB): se configurares meuclube.com, qualquer email @meuclube.com entra diretamente sem fila.
  • Cada link é revogável a qualquer momento.
Pro tip clubes Para um clube com muitos sócios, partilha 1 link no WhatsApp do clube + ativa auto-aprovação por domínio. Os sócios entram sozinhos sem sobrecarregar o admin.
Convites
— Recebidos —
M
Segundas Indoor
Convidam-te como Editor
Rejeitar
Aceitar
— Enviados por ti —
A
ana@correio…
Editor · Há 2 dias
Pendente
+ Convidar
07

Lixo

Onde aterram as partidas eliminadas. Recuperáveis enquanto não as tiveres apagado permanentemente.

Sempre que apagas uma partida (a partir de Admin → Partidas ou do menu da partida), não é eliminada de imediato: vai para o lixo. Aqui podes:

Restaurar
Volta à lista ativa. Se a partida afetava o ELO, é recalculado automaticamente.
Apagar permanentemente
Adeus para sempre. Esta é irreversível — nem os backups recuperam algo apagado permanentemente.
Custo zero Ter partidas no lixo não consome quota PRO nem deixa a app mais lenta. Limpa só se quiseres ordem.
Lixo (2)
×
Seg 26 Mai 19:00
Pablo/Diego vs Fer/Óscar
Restaurar
Apagar
×
Sex 23 Mai 20:30
Indoor · 2-1
08

Manutenção

Em "Opções avançadas". Importar/exportar, backups e reset. Ações potentes — algumas irreversíveis, lê-as com cuidado.

CSV — importar / exportar

Importar CSV
Carrega partidas e jogadores a partir de um ficheiro. Detetamos duplicados por data + jogadores. Útil para migrar de Excel ou de outra app.
Exportar CSV
Descarrega toda a liga (jogadores + partidas) num único ficheiro. Bom formato para Excel/Sheets ou para guardar um backup manual.

Backups

Exportar backup
Snapshot completo da liga (formato próprio): rankings, sedes, partidas, membros, tudo. Para restaurar tens de usar "Restaurar backup".
Restaurar backup
Sobrescreve o estado atual com o do backup. Avisa antes todos os membros — as alterações desde o backup perdem-se.

Reset de dados

Reset de temporada
Apaga as partidas da temporada atual. Plantel, sedes e membros mantêm-se. Boa para arrancar a temporada seguinte do zero.
Reset total de dados
Apaga tudo exceto a própria liga: partidas, jogadores, sedes, histórico. A liga fica vazia como recém-criada. Sem volta atrás.
Antes de tocar no reset Exporta sempre um backup primeiro. Mesmo que o "reset de temporada" respeite jogadores e sedes, um engano em produção dói. 30 segundos de backup poupam-te um desgosto.

Demo só de leitura

Se estás a ver a liga demo (a que se cria ao instalar a app com dados de exemplo), aparece um banner amarelo e todas as ações de manutenção estão desativadas. A demo serve apenas para veres a app a funcionar com dados reais.